    About the property

    Second and third floor duplex apartment situated within a warehouse conversion which was professionally redeveloped around 20 years ago. It is well presented internally and in move-in condition. It has a mixture of electric storage heating on the lower level and electric panel heating on the upper level. There are traditional sash and case windows to the front and UPVC double glazing to the rear. The property has superb views of Arthur’s Seat to the front and is well located for Edinburgh University’s different campuses.

    The accommodation comprises:

    • Entrance hall with deep storage cupboard beneath the stairs housing the electricity meters and consumer units

    • Generously proportioned living room with laminate flooring and cornicing

    • Fitted kitchen with a range of modern style gloss white units with laminate marble effect worktops and appliances including a ceramic hob, electric fan oven, dishwasher, fridge, freezer and washer dryer

    • The upstairs landing has a storage cupboard housing the hot water cylinder and there is a hatch to access the private loft space which provides excellent storage

    • Rear facing double bedroom with window seat and pleasant views of Arthur’s seat

    • Further good sized double bedroom with built-in wardrobes

    • Master bedroom with large built-in wardrobes and en-suite bathroom with heated towel rail, fan heater, bath, fitted bathroom furniture with WC and inset wash basin; electric shower over the bath; shelved linen cupboard

    • Family bathroom with partially tiled walls; tiled flooring and bath with electric shower over, WC and fitted furniture; heated towel rail

    There are private gardens, an allocated parking space bike store, bin store and outside water tap.
